1. Metal recycling
Awareness of an object's end-of-life is a growing concept in our modern society, which until now has been primarily oriented towards consumption, creativity, development and growth.
It's easy to understand, however, that capital goods and consumer products are no different from human beings: their lives are short-lived.
If all goods were biodegradable, at least within a reasonable timeframe, we probably wouldn't need to wonder about their fate. The persistent existence of used goods in a state of progressive degradation, and the inconvenience they eventually generate, introduces the concept of waste.
